Accel Entertainment, Inc. (NYSE:ACEL) Short Interest Update

Accel Entertainment, Inc. (NYSE:ACELGet Free Report) was the recipient of a significant decline in short interest in February. As of February 28th, there was short interest totalling 799,400 shares, a decline of 13.4% from the February 13th total of 922,900 shares.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 313,100 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is presently 2.6 days. Approximately 1.6% of the shares of the stock are sold short.

Accel Entertainment Price Performance

Accel Entertainment stock opened at $10.04 on Friday. The company has a market cap of $858.60 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of 19.68 and a beta of 1.54. The firm’s fifty day moving average is $11.06 and its 200 day moving average is $11.27. The company has a quick ratio of 2.63, a current ratio of 2.71 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 2.54. Accel Entertainment has a 52-week low of $9.37 and a 52-week high of $12.96.

Insider Transactions at Accel Entertainment

In other news, Director David W. Ruttenberg sold 25,000 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ction on Tuesday, February 18th. The shares were sold at an average price of $12.35, for a total value of $308,750.00. Following the transaction, the director now owns 335,635 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$4,145,092.25. The trade was a 6.93 % dec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through this hyperlink. Insiders own 19.17% of the company’s stock.

About Accel Entertainment

Accel Entertainment,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a distributed gaming operator in the United States. It is involved in the installation, maintenance, and operation of gaming terminals; redemption devices that disburse winnings and contain automated teller machine (ATM) functionality; and other amusement devices in authorized non-casino locations, such as restaurants, bars, taverns, convenience stores, liquor stores, truck stops, and grocery stores.
